Steve’s Wood Fired Pizza (Boca Raton)
Posted on December 19th, 2007 · Boca Raton Italian Pizza

***** Steve’s Wood Fired Pizza
9180 Glades Road
Boca Raton, Florida 33434
(561) 483-5665

Steve’s Wood Fired Pizza is a “pizza joint” that you have to try…no, make that, you must try. This “hole in the wall” joint, located in the back of a large Boca Raton strip-shopping center, makes some of the most delicious thin crisp (10″) pizzas that you have ever tasted. Steve’s pizza-selection is so huge, that I suggest that you visit its website at www.steveswoodfiredpizza.com and take a look at its menu. This joint also makes some top-notch appetizers, salads, soups, sandwiches, wraps, pastas and desserts.

Like I said before, Steve’s is an absolute hole in the wall, with maybe a half-dozen tables. This is strictly a tee shirt/shorts kind of a joint and you can see the kitchen from any seat in the house.

Steve’s is open Monday 4pm-9pm, Tuesday-Saturday 11:30am-9:30pm and Sunday 3pm-9pm.

Brass Ring Pub (North Palm Beach)
Posted on October 29th, 2008 · American
***** Brass Ring Pub, 200 U.S. Highway 1, North Palm Beach, Florida 33408 (561) 848-4748.

If you get yourself a copy of Webster’s Dictionary and look up the defintion of the word “joint”…I’ll bet you that a picture of the Brass Ring Pub is there. Guaranteed, that if you weren’t explicitedly looking for this joint, you would never-ever stop at this restaurant-pub in a million years.

Let’s make this review as simple as possibe…HOLE IN THE WALL…WOOD BOOTHS AND TABLES…WALLS COVERED IN GRAFFITI… TVS-POOL TABLES…OUTRAGEOUSLY GREAT HAMBURGERS AND OUTRAGEOUSLY GREAT CHICKEN WINGS.

Last night was my first time. I loved everything about this joint and unless you are an old “fuddy-duddy” you will too!

The Brass Ring Pub is open 7 days a week 11am-1:30am.

Jay & The Americans/Dennis Tufano/The Happenings (Barbara B. Mann Performing Arts Hall- Fort Myers)

Posted on November 27th, 2014 · Music/Events/Other · 1 Comment »

* Jay & The American/Dennis Tufano/The Happenings.

This is gonna be a terrific oldies-show. No question in Jeff Eats mind, SRO!

A drop of “history”…my brother-in-law Chuck was The Happenings’ original- manager . Chuck’s the guy that brought the group to- The Tokens who produced The Happenings’ 1966 breakout hit “See You In September” By the way, original lead singer Bobby Miranda still fronts the group and- sounds just like he did back in ’66.

***** Pomperdale New York Style Deli, 3055 East Commercial Boulevard, Fort Lauderdale, Florida 33308, (954) 771-9830.

The Pomperdale Deli has been in business for nearly 40 years. I found this joint about 16 years ago and have probably eaten lunch there ar least 50 times.

If you like good…no make that great deli and appetizing…then this joint is for you. No waiters…order at the counter…No checks, just tell the guy at the register what you had.

This is probably the best “kosher style” deli in South Florida. As a matter of fact, it may very well be the best deli in Florida. The food is absolutely terrific. This joint is open 7 days a week…Monday-Saturday 6am-5pm and Sunday 6am-3pm.

Don’t miss this joint…it is a one of a kind.

* Hotel Tonight.

Got something great-for you guys…Hotel Tonight (hoteltonight.com).

Now, try and follow Jeff Eats, Hotel Tonight is a MOBILE ONLY servuce…

Hotels- basically list their excess room inventory “at the last minute” on Hotel Tonight

Hotel Tonight describes itself as…”The world is going mobile, and there’s a growing demand for always-on tools that provide immediate satisfaction. While web distribution makes perfect sense for guests researching vacations well in advance, HotelTonight’s all-mobile platform allows you to reach the increasing number of guests who are choosing to be more spontaneous about their decisions. Because we’re mobile only, the rates you load are exclusively available on our app – not online or anywhere else. No one can search for your hotel or predict which hotels will be on display. Your offer is protected – we deliver only truly incremental guests you wouldn’t have otherwise attracted.”

Rather than listening to computer/tech illiterate Jeff Eats babble on…go to Hotel Tonight’s site for info…I do know that you’ll need to download its “app” to use its free service.

All I can tell you, is that the room rates that it lists are amazingly-reasonable!
